Technical field
This utility model is related to a kind of oiling device, more particularly to oiling device.
Background technology
In process of manufacture, it is often necessary to carry out oiling operation to part, carrying out when oiling is operated mostly at present Oiling is carried out to part by oil gun for artificial, even if oil injection operation is carried out using equipment, when for gossamery product, in note Be easy to occur when oily oiling pin collide product and so that product is subjected to displacement so that during follow-up oiling cannot oiling to accurately On position, oiling operation failure is caused also to need manually to be remedied, it is very inconvenient.
Utility model content
The technical problem that this utility model is solved is to provide one kind and conveniently carries out oil injection operation so that product will not occur position The oiling device of shifting.

Specific embodiment
With reference to the accompanying drawings and detailed description this utility model is further illustrated.
Oiling device as shown in Figures 1 to 4, including casing, are provided with operating platform, on the operating platform in casing It is provided with product and places carrier 1, the product is placed to be provided with below carrier 1 and drives product to place what carrier 1 was moved in Y-axis Carrier drive mechanism 2, the oiling device driving machine also moved in X-axis and Z axis including oiling device 3 and driving oiling device 3 Structure 4, the product are placed carrier 1 and include placing and be provided with what is be engaged with shape of product on support plate 11 described in the support plate 11 of product Die orifice, the die orifice insertion support plate 11 are arranged, and be provided with base plate 12, be provided with side between base plate 12 and support plate 11 below support plate 11 Plate 13 causes base plate 12, support plate 11 and side plate 13 to form cavity, is provided with multiple check-valves 15, each check-valves in the cavity 15 are corresponded with each die orifice, and multiple through holes being connected with 15 suction hole of check-valves are provided with the base plate 12, described every Individual through hole is connected to the side of base plate 12 by gas channel 14, the air-breathing outside connection at 12 side gas channel 14 of base plate Device, also including controller, the controller connects with carrier drive mechanism 2 and oiling device drive mechanism 4 respectively, work When, product being placed on die orifice, the getter device outside startup, the getter device is commercially available existing product Product, cause product firmly to be inhaled on support plate 11 in the presence of check-valves 15, and controller controls carrier drive mechanism 2 and note Oily device driving mechanism 4 is moved so that oiling device 3 can reach each position that product places carrier 1, is realized to the complete of product Orientation oiling operation, due to arranging below support plate 11 as check-valves 15, due to check-valves, 15 allow media to a direction Flowing, air-flow cannot flow backwards, therefore after a product on a die orifice is taken away, the air-flow on other die orifices will not also be produced It is raw to affect so that even if not piling product on support plate 11, place the check-valves 15 below the die orifice of product and also remain to product Hold, realize the fixation of product.
Controller described above is prior art, and those skilled in the art voluntarily can be set according to principle described above Corresponding circuit is counted out, therefore here is just repeated no more.
On the basis of described above, the oiling device drive mechanism 4 includes the linear module of X-axis, the linear module of the X-axis On be provided with the first slide block, be provided with the linear module of Y-axis on first slide block, on the linear module of the Y-axis, be provided with second Slide block, mounting rotary electric machine on the second slide block, the oiling device 3 are arranged on below electric rotating machine so that during oiling Carry out rotary oiling.
On the basis of described above, two check-valves 15, and two 15 edges of check-valves below described each die orifice, are provided with The central point of die orifice is arranged so that check-valves 15 can make product more stable when product is held, will not double swerve.
Additionally, also including being arranged on base plate 12 sealing block 16 for sealing 15 suction hole of check-valves, sealing block 16 setting can be prevented in air-breathing, the gas leakage at 15 suction hole of check-valves, so as to affect adsorption effect.
Additionally, the oiling device 3 includes oiling device mounting blocks 31, also including arc block 32, set in the middle part of arc block 32 Kidney slot 33 is equipped with, the arc block 32 is arranged on mounting blocks by kidney slot 33 and can be slided in kidney slot 33, described One end of arc block 32 is provided with fuel feeding valve 34, and oiling pin is provided with 34 oil-out of fuel feeding valve, connects at 34 oil-in of fuel feeding valve Oily cylinder is connected to, due to the setting of arc block 32 and kidney slot 33 so that can realize to oiling pin by adjusting arc block 32 Angle adjustment so that oiling device 3 is when oiling is operated so that the side wall of the groove smeared needed for product can also be applied to be spread Oil.
Additionally, XYZ fine adjustment stages 35 between the arc block 32 and fuel feeding valve 34, are provided with, the XYZ fine adjustment stages 35 Setting can realize the fine setting to oiling pin direction so that the syringe needle of oiling pin is accurately in oiling device drive mechanism It is on central shaft, more accurate in oil injection operation.
Additionally, also including the detachable syringe needle locating piece 36 on oiling device mounting blocks 31, the syringe needle is fixed Position block 36 is provided with vertical vertical slot 37 towards on oiling pin side, in the position of the vertical slot 37 and the rotation of oiling device 3 Heart axle is vertical, when oiling device 3 is installed, first syringe needle locating piece 36 is arranged on oiling device mounting blocks 31, then right again Fuel feeding valve 34 carries out angle adjustment so that the syringe needle of oiling pin is located in vertical slot 37, can now be ensured when oiling is operated, oiling The syringe needle of pin can be located at same point rotation so that oiling operate when it is more accurate, therefore the setting of syringe needle locating piece 36 facilitate it is right The regulation in oiling pin direction.
Additionally, also including being arranged on the syringe needle check block 6 that product places 1 side of carrier, at the top of the syringe needle check block 6 it is Conical structure, after the direction of oiling pin has been adjusted, oiling needle movement is to above syringe needle check block 6 and controls for controller control 360 degree of oiling pin rotates and carries out oiling operation, and whether manual observation oil is located at the top of syringe needle check block 6, so as to judge oiling Whether pin adjusts accurately.
Additionally, also including that being arranged on product places the optical fiber of 1 side of carrier compared with pin module 7, the optical fiber is wrapped compared with pin module 7 Optical fiber base plate 71 is included, first Fibre Optical Sensor 72 on four sides of the optical fiber base plate 71, is each provided with, relative two Individual first Fibre Optical Sensor 72 forms one group of Fibre Optical Sensor to penetrating, the Fibre Optical Sensor and controller connection, due to The collision of syringe needle and product can occur in oiling operating process, so as to cause the flexural deformation of oiling pin, oiling process is caused Affect, therefore during oiling, after the time of one end, it is interior compared with pin module 7 simultaneously to optical fiber that controller will control oiling needle movement All around moved in optical fiber is compared with pin module 7, four the first Fibre Optical Sensors 72 can be obtained according to the distance to oiling pin Go out the whether flexural deformation of oiling pin, after deformation is detected, staff can be reminded in time to be readjusted, prevent bending from becoming The oiling of shape is impacted for oiling precision.
Additionally, also including being arranged on two second optical fiber of 2 side of carrier drive mechanism for controlling carrier movement travel Sensor 21, product place that to be provided with sensing below carrier fast, and the second Fibre Optical Sensor 21 can sense the process of sensor block, and two Arranging for individual second Fibre Optical Sensor 21 can be manipulated to the motion of carrier formation so that carrier is moved in certain stroke It is dynamic.
Additionally, action pane and alarm device are provided with the casing, the action pane both sides are provided with safety light Grid 5, the safe grating 5 and alarm device are connected with controller respectively, when operator are carrying out compared with pin or placing product During, safe grating 5 senses the both hands of operator, and signal is reached controller, controller control device by safe grating 5 Cannot start, when the handss of placement operation personnel are operated in the casing, equipment starts suddenly and causes the safety hazard to operator, Alarm device is then controlled after controller detects oiling pin flexural deformation by optical fiber compared with pin module 7 and sends alarm, remind behaviour Make personnel to be adjusted oiling pin in time, prevent diastrophic oiling from impacting for follow-up oiling precision.
